- Official Microsoft Excel Training: Microsoft offers official training materials, including video courses and practice exercises, to get you started. They will help prepare you for the exam. You can often find this training on the Microsoft website. These materials are designed to align with the MOS certification objectives and cover all the necessary topics. These are usually comprehensive and up-to-date with the latest versions of Excel. They often include interactive exercises and quizzes. Make sure you use the official materials to ensure that you are studying the correct content.
- Certiport-Approved Study Guides: Certiport also publishes study guides and practice tests that are specifically designed for the MOS Excel exam. These are usually the best option for passing the exam. These resources are often available in both print and digital formats, so you can choose the option that best suits your needs. These guides provide a structured approach to learning the material. Also, they will cover all the objectives and include practice questions. These are often the most reliable way to prepare for the certification exam.
- Online Courses: There are many online platforms, such as Udemy, Coursera, and LinkedIn Learning, that offer Excel courses specifically designed to prepare you for the MOS certification. These courses will cover all the necessary topics and often include practice exercises, quizzes, and even practice exams. These can be a great way to learn at your own pace and review the material as many times as you want. Look for courses with positive reviews and instructors with experience in the field. These platforms provide a wide range of learning options, from beginner to advanced. Make sure that the course you choose matches the Excel version you will be tested on.
- Practice Tests: Practice tests are crucial for success. They allow you to test your knowledge, identify your weak areas, and get familiar with the exam format. Certiport provides practice tests, and other providers offer them as well. The practice tests can help you get a sense of how the exam will feel. These are designed to simulate the actual exam environment. This will help you to manage your time and reduce anxiety. Use them to identify any gaps in your knowledge. Focus on these areas during your further studies. Take the practice tests under exam conditions. This will help you get used to the time constraints and the pressure of the exam.

What is the MOS Excel Certification? Unveiling the Credential
Okay, so what exactly is the MOS Excel Certification? Simply put, it's a globally recognized credential that validates your proficiency in Microsoft Excel. Certiport, a leading provider of certification exams, administers these tests, and passing them proves you have the skills to work effectively with Excel. This is not just about knowing the basics, guys; it's about demonstrating your ability to use Excel's more advanced features. This includes creating and managing spreadsheets, working with formulas and functions, creating charts and graphs, and analyzing data. Getting this certification proves that you have the skills necessary to use the software on a more professional level. Step 1: Know the Exam Objectives
The first thing you should do is familiarize yourself with the exam objectives. Certiport provides a detailed list of the skills and concepts covered in the MOS Excel exam. This is your roadmap, your guide to what you need to study. Download the official exam objectives from the Certiport website. This document outlines everything you need to know, including specific features and functions. Make sure you understand each objective. These may include using formulas, formatting cells, managing worksheets, creating charts, and analyzing data. Be aware that the objectives can vary slightly depending on the specific version of Excel you are taking the exam for (e.g., Excel 2016, Excel 2019, Excel 365). Don't just skim through the objectives. You'll need to study each one. Then, make sure you thoroughly understand each of them. Use this list to create your study plan. Identify your weaknesses. Focus on the areas where you need the most improvement. Prioritize your study time based on the objectives. This will help you focus your efforts. This document is a critical tool for your preparation. It will help ensure that you cover all the necessary topics. If you don't know the content of the exam, you can't be well-prepared.

Step 3: Create a Study Plan
Having the right resources is only half the battle. You also need a solid study plan. Allocate specific time slots in your schedule for studying. Treat it like any other important appointment. Be consistent and stick to your plan as much as possible. Break down the exam objectives into smaller, manageable chunks. This will help you to avoid feeling overwhelmed and make your study sessions more effective. Review each objective thoroughly, practice the skills, and test your knowledge. Set realistic goals. Don't try to cram everything at once. This can lead to burnout. Start early and give yourself plenty of time to study. This will help you retain the information better. Revise your plan as needed. If you find that you're struggling with a particular topic, adjust your study time. Make sure you are using all available resources. This might include videos, study guides, and practice tests. The key is to find a system that works for you. You have to find a good balance.

Step 5: Take Practice Exams
As mentioned earlier, practice exams are essential. They simulate the real exam, allowing you to get familiar with the format and identify areas where you need to improve. Take practice exams as if they were the actual exam. Set a timer and stick to the time limit. This will help you get used to the pace of the exam. After completing a practice exam, review your answers carefully. Focus on your mistakes and understand why you got them wrong. Identify any areas where you are struggling. Use the results to adjust your study plan and focus your efforts on those areas. Take as many practice exams as possible. The more you take, the more comfortable you'll become with the exam format. Use the practice exams as a way to build your confidence and refine your test-taking strategies. Practice exams are the closest thing to the real thing.
